As of July 20, Vietnam attracted US$12.94 billion in FDI, up 46.9% against the same period last year, according to the General Statistics Office.
Of the total, nearly US$8.7 billion came from 1,408 new projects and the remaining from 660 added-capital projects.
Investors poured money into new projects across 47 provinces and cities nationwide in the period.Hai Phong topped the country in attracting new FDI projects, followed by Hanoi, and southern Binh Duong and Dong Nai provinces, and Ho Chi Minh City.
